The video tutorial covers the concept of volume for various geometric solids, including prisms, cylinders, cubes, and trapezoidal prisms. It explains the formula for volume as the area of the base times the height and emphasizes the importance of identifying the correct height. The tutorial provides examples for calculating the volume of a triangular prism, a cylinder, a cube, and a trapezoidal prism, highlighting the need to understand the geometric properties of each shape.
